Nov 29, 2024

Druk Wanggyel Tshechu

Druk Wangyel Tshechu– The Dochula Pass is between Thimphu and Punakha, where 108 memorial chortens or stupas known as “Druk Wangyal Chortens” have been built by Ashi Dorji Wangmo Wangchuk, the eldest Queen Mother of Bhutan. Just above the pass there is open courtyard where Druk Wangyel Festival takes place. The Druk Wangyel Tshechu is a unique […]

Nov 26, 2024

Savor the Flavors of Traveling to Bhutan

This traditional snack, made from areca nut, betel leaf, and lime, is a vibrant part of Bhutanese culture. Doma isn’t just a treat; it is a symbol of gratitude and social connection, often shared during ceremonies. It dates back to the 8th century and represents key human elements: the leaf for skin, the nut for […]

Nov 20, 2024

Bhutan to allow entry and exit of international visitors from Eastern Bhutan.

International tourists can now finally enter and exit from the eastern border town of Samdrupjongkhar, following the official inauguration yesterday. With this, visitors can now travel to eastern Bhutan which receives very less international visitors. The new gateway would facilitate travel to major towns of eastern Bhutan—Trashigang, Trashiyangtse, Mongar, Lhuentse, and Pemagatshel. These locations, although […]

Nov 8, 2024

Notification on Fast-Track Tourist Visa/Permit Services

The Department of Immigration, Ministry of Home Affairs is pleased to introduce Fast-Track visa/permit processing services for tourist with effect from 01 November 2024. The DoI shall convey the outcome of a fast-track application within 24 hours of the confirmation of the receipt of all applicable fees. A fast-track processing fee of USD 10 per […]
